We arrived at the Fair about nine thirty and got into our track suits to limber up our legs before the Meet opened. At ten o'eloek. the eommittee in eharge announced the one hundred yard dash. ln this event Joseph Tognarelli was first, Russell Purrington was seeond, and Farley Manning was third. Tl1e time was eleven and one fifth seconds. The next event was the half mile. Herman Herzig took first plaee and Jolm Hillman third plaee. The time was two minutes and t.hirty-three seeonds. The half mile relay race came next. Our team took first plaee and was made up of Donald Purrington, Russell Purrington, Harold Herzig, and Joseph Tognarelli. ln tl1e broad jump Joseph Tognarelli jumped eighteen feet and nine inehes taking first plaee. John Burnham jumped seven- teen feet and Hve inehes taking seeond plaee and Farley Manning jumped seve11- teen feet and three inehes taking third plaee. The next event was the three legged race and Joseph Tognarelli and Russell Purrington took second plaee. ln the running high jump Jolm Burnham tied with NV. Putney of Charlemont for first plaee at five feet and three inehes. The last event was to be a potato raee but sinee it was about twelve-thirty o'eloek it was deeided to eall it off and the Traek Meet ended.
